Decoding the Total Price of Your Mercedes-Benz

The journey to owning a Mercedes-Benz often begins with understanding the “Total Price.” It’s important to note that the price you initially see is typically a starting point. This “Starting at” price is the base price, but it’s subject to adjustments based on several factors. Once you provide a ZIP code to a Mercedes-Benz dealer, estimated taxes and fees are added to give you a “Total Price.” However, remember that this is still an estimate.

The final price can vary depending on the specific Mercedes-Benz dealership location and your location as the customer. Inventory levels at the dealership also play a role, as does the configuration of the vehicle itself. The features you choose to add and any available discounts or rebates will further refine the final price. Keep in mind that adding extra products or services to your deal will also impact the overall cost. Therefore, while the displayed “Total Price” is a helpful indicator, it’s essential to confirm the final price with your local Mercedes-Benz dealer.

Performance Metrics: Acceleration and What Influences It

Mercedes-Benz vehicles are renowned for their performance, and acceleration is a key metric. When you see stated acceleration rates, understand that these are typically estimated based on manufacturer track results. Real-world acceleration can vary. Factors such as the specific model, environmental conditions, road surface conditions, and even your driving style will influence how quickly your Mercedes-Benz accelerates. Elevation and the vehicle’s load are also contributing factors. So, while those impressive acceleration figures give you a benchmark, your actual experience may differ based on these variables.

Fuel Economy and Driving Range: Key Considerations

For many drivers, fuel economy is a significant factor. Mercedes-Benz provides EPA-estimated fuel economy figures to help you compare models. It’s important to remember that these are estimates, and your actual mileage can vary. How fast you drive, weather conditions, and the length of your trips all play a role. For highway driving, you’ll likely experience mileage that is less than the highway estimate.

For electric Mercedes-Benz models, driving range is a primary consideration. The EPA also provides estimated driving ranges for fully charged batteries. However, similar to fuel economy in gasoline vehicles, the actual driving range of an electric Mercedes-Benz can vary. Factors like the specific model, terrain, temperature, driving style, optional equipment, and the use of vehicle features all contribute to the real-world range you’ll experience.

Electric Vehicle Charging Offers: Incentives for Going Electric

Mercedes-Benz is committed to electric mobility and often provides incentives for retail customers who purchase or lease new electric models like the EQB, EQE, EQS, or G 580. These offers can include options like a Mercedes-Benz Home Wallbox (though installation may not be included) or a charging voucher. This voucher can often be applied to your Mercedes me Charge account for public charging within the Mercedes me Charge network and can be valid for up to two years.

It’s important to note that specific terms and conditions apply to these electric charging offers. The selection of the offer must typically be made when you take delivery of your vehicle. These offers are often non-refundable, non-transferable, and subject to change or discontinuation.
